Career
In the 1830s he served as lieutenant. Later he became a talented agriculturist landowner in Szabadka area, who following the steps of Count István Széchenyi gained distinction by developing Hungarian horse breeding. Cseszneky was the patron of the notable poet, Pál Jámbor (Hiador) and - following the advice of Lajos Kossuth - the advocate of Mihály Vörösmarty"s election in the Bácsalmás electoral district to the parliament.
Due to his role in the Hungarian Revolution of 1848 he suffered serious reprisal under the Serbian Voivodship.
